خط را مدیریت کنید دستورات در لینوکس این می تواند یک کار پیچیده یا ترسناک برای اکثر کاربران تازه کار باشد. با این حال، کاربران با دانش و درک صحیح از دستورات اولیه می توانند عملیات موثر و کارآمدی را بر روی این قدرتمند انجام دهند سیستم عامل. این مقاله یک راهنمای دقیق در مورد "چگونه در لینوکس به ابتدای خط برویم؟"، دانش بسیار مهم برای مدیریت دستورات و اسکریپت های طولانی در terminal de Linux.
لینوکس، شناخته شده به عنوان یکی از سیستم عاملها همه کاره ترین و انعطاف پذیرترین نرم افزار منبع باز از خط فرمان برای چندین کار، از مدیریت فایل ها تا پیکربندی نرم افزار، استفاده گسترده ای می کند. تسلط صحیح آن، کارایی و بهره وری کاربر را افزایش می دهد و آن را به منبعی ارزشمند برای هر متخصص فناوری تبدیل می کند.+
آشنایی با سیستم خط در لینوکس
اول از همه، درک آن بسیار مهم است دستورات پایه ترمینال لینوکس تا بتوانید به طور موثر در خطوط کد حرکت کنید. یکی از رایج ترین حرکات رفتن به جلوی خط است. تصور کنید که یک دستور طولانی یا آدرس فایل را در ترمینال تایپ کرده اید، اما متوجه می شوید که در همان ابتدا اشتباه کرده اید و باید آن را اصلاح کنید. به جای استفاده از کلیدهای جهت دار برای حرکت آهسته به شروع، می توانید از دستور Ctrl+A استفاده کنید. این دستور به طور خودکار مکان نما شما را به ابتدای خط مورد نظر منتقل می کند و به شما امکان می دهد آنچه را که نیاز دارید را به روشی بسیار سریعتر و کارآمدتر تغییر دهید یا حذف کنید.
همچنین اگر در وسط خط هستید و می خواهید به ابتدا بروید، می توانید از ترکیب استفاده کنید Ctrl + فلش چپ. این به شما این امکان را می دهد که به جای حرکت نویسه به کاراکتر، در میان بلوک های متن سریعتر حرکت کنید. علاوه بر این، میانبرهای دیگری نیز وجود دارد که میتوانند استفاده کنند برای حرکت سریعتر در خطوطی مانند:
- Ctrl + فلش سمت راست: برای حرکت به انتهای کلمه.
- Ctrl+U: برای حذف از مکان نما تا ابتدای خط.
- Ctrl+K: برای حذف از مکان نما تا انتهای خط.
هنگامی که با این دستورات تمرین کنید، خواهید دید که کارایی شما در استفاده از ترمینال لینوکس به طور قابل توجهی افزایش می یابد.
کنترل خط فرمان برای بازگشت به ابتدای یک خط
در بسیاری از موارد، هنگام کار با خط دستور در لینوکس، ممکن است لازم باشد چندین بار به ابتدای خط متن بروید. ممکن است دستوری را اصلاح کنید، اشتباه تایپی را تصحیح کنید، یا بخواهید آنچه را که تایپ کرده اید مرور کنید. حرکت دادن حرف به حرف یا کلمه به کلمه اغلب خسته کننده و زمان بر است. ساختن این فرآیند ساده تر و مؤثرتر، لینوکس میانبرهای صفحه کلید خاصی را ارائه می دهد که به شما امکان می دهد به سرعت به ابتدای خط فرمان بروید. رایج ترین راه برای انجام این کار استفاده از کلید ترکیبی است کنترل + الف. وقتی این کلیدها را فشار می دهید، مکان نما به طور خودکار به ابتدای خطی که روی آن کار می کنید حرکت می کند.
سایر میانبرهای صفحه کلید که ممکن است مفید باشند عبارتند از: کنترل + ای برای رفتن به انتهای خط، کنترل + U برای حذف از موقعیت مکان نما تا ابتدای خط و Ctrl + K برای حذف از موقعیت مکان نما تا انتهای خط. توجه به این نکته ضروری است که این میانبرها فقط در خط فرمان لینوکس کار می کنند و نه در پردازشگرهای کلمه عمومی. در برخی از این ها، مانند Gedit یا LibreOffice، این ترکیب ها می توانند عملکردهای متفاوتی داشته باشند. در اینجا یک لیست بدون شماره از مفیدترین میانبرها آمده است:
- کنترل + الف: به ابتدای خط بروید.
- کنترل + ای: به انتهای خط بروید.
- کنترل + U: حذف از مکان نما تا ابتدای خط.
- Ctrl + K: از مکان نما تا انتهای خط حذف کنید.
هدف ما این است که به شما کمک کنیم با این میانبرها آشنا شوید تا بتوانید سریعتر و کارآمدتر در خط فرمان لینوکس کار کنید. آنها را امتحان کنید و ببینید چقدر می توانید در زمان خود صرفه جویی کنید!
استفاده از میانبرهای صفحه کلید برای اسکرول کارآمد در لینوکس
صفحه کلید می تواند قدرتمندترین متحد شما باشد زمانی که روی یک سیستم لینوکس کار می کنید. معمولاً استفاده از میانبرهای صفحه کلید برای پیمایش خط فرمان سریعتر و کارآمدتر از استفاده از ماوس است. به طور خاص، رفتن به ابتدای خط یک عملیات رایج است که با یک میانبر صفحه کلید ساده می توان سرعت آن را افزایش داد. اما قبل از پرداختن به آن، مهم است که با برخی از اصطلاحات اولیه آشنا شوید. برای کاربران de Linux,
- پوسته: رابط کاربری است که امکان دسترسی به خدمات مختلف را فراهم می کند از سیستم عامل.
- Bash: نوعی پوسته است، که استفاده میشه به طور گسترده ای به دلیل رابط کاربری آسان و ویژگی های قدرتمند آن.
در آن Bash shell، می توانید از میانبر صفحه کلید "Ctrl + a" برای رفتن به ابتدای خط فعلی متن استفاده کنید. این یک راه بسیار سریعتر برای حرکت مکان نما نسبت به کلیک کردن در نقطه دقیق با ماوس است. اگر در حال ویرایش یک فایل طولانی هستید یا روی یک خط فرمان پیچیده کار می کنید، این میانبر صفحه کلید می تواند در زمان زیادی صرفه جویی کند. در اینجا نحوه استفاده از آن آمده است:
- خط فرمان Bash (یا هر ویرایشگر متن دیگری در ترمینال) را باز کنید.
- چیزی را در خط فرمان تایپ کنید یا به خط متنی که قبلاً تایپ شده است بروید.
- "Ctrl + a" را فشار دهید. مکان نما شما به ابتدای خط متن ارسال می شود.
به سادگی با این میانبر تمرین کنید تا زمانی که افزایش چشمگیر کارایی شما به عادت تبدیل شود. در محل کار con Linux.
کاوش سایر روش های مفید برای مرور خطوط طولانی در لینوکس
در زیر روشهای مؤثر و کاربردی دیگری را ارائه خواهیم کرد که میتواند به استفاده مؤثرتر از آن کمک کند terminal Linuxبه خصوص وقتی صحبت از پیمایش در صف های طولانی می شود.
یکی از این روش ها استفاده از میانبرهای صفحه کلید Bash. مثلا با فشار دادن کنترل + الف، مکان نما به طور خودکار به ابتدای خط حرکت می کند و در زمان و تلاش صرفه جویی می کند. همچنین برای انتقال مکان نما به انتهای خط می توانید از کنترل + ای. این دستورات هنگام کار با خطوط فرمان طولانی و پیچیده مفید هستند.
Además, puedes usar el comando history برای پیمایش از طریق دستورات استفاده شده قبلی. با وارد کردن "history" در ترمینال، لیستی از دستورات اخیرا استفاده شده را دریافت خواهید کرد. از اینجا می توانید هر دستور قبلی را بدون نیاز به تایپ مجدد آن انتخاب کرده و مجدداً استفاده کنید.
یکی دیگر از گزینه های مفید دستور "صفحه نمایش" است.. این دستور به شما اجازه می دهد که چندین ترمینال داشته باشید در یک تک، به شما امکان می دهد سریع و آسان بین آنها جابجا شوید. این به ویژه در صورتی مفید است که با چندین رشته دستور کار می کنید و نیاز به جابجایی مکرر بین آنها دارید.
به یاد داشته باشید که با تمرین و آگاهی از این دستورات و میانبرها می توانید زمان زیادی را صرفه جویی کنید و کار خود را با لینوکس بسیار کارآمدتر کنید. نکته کلیدی این است که با آنها آشنا شوید و به طور منظم از آنها استفاده کنید.
من سباستین ویدال هستم، یک مهندس کامپیوتر علاقه مند به فناوری و DIY. علاوه بر این، من خالق آن هستم tecnobits.com، جایی که من آموزش هایی را به اشتراک می گذارم تا فناوری را برای همه قابل دسترس تر و قابل درک تر کنم.